Frequently Asked Questions about Deep Groove Ball Bearings

What is a deep groove ball bearing?

A deep groove ball bearing is a common type of rolling-element bearing. It features a raceway groove that is deeper than the ball radius, allowing it to handle both radial and axial loads effectively.

What is the difference between deep groove and shallow groove ball bearings?

Deep groove ball bearings have a deeper raceway groove, allowing them to handle higher radial and axial loads. Shallow groove bearings are designed for lighter loads and higher speeds.

What is the meaning of deep groove?

Deep groove refers to the shape of the raceway in these bearings. It's a continuous, non-filling groove that allows the bearing to handle both radial and axial loads effectively.

What is a deep groove ball bearing?

A deep groove ball bearing is the most common type of rolling-element bearing. It has a single or double row of balls in a deep raceway groove, designed to handle both radial and axial loads in both directions.

What are the main components of a deep groove ball bearing?

The main components are the inner ring, outer ring, balls (rolling elements), and a cage (separator) which holds the balls in place and guides their movement.

What types of loads can deep groove ball bearings handle?

Deep groove ball bearings can handle radial loads (perpendicular to the shaft) and axial loads (parallel to the shaft) in both directions. They are particularly well-suited for radial loads but can also accommodate moderate axial loads.

Where are deep groove ball bearings typically used?

They are widely used in various applications including electric motors, automotive systems (e.g., transmissions, hubs), industrial machinery, pumps, fans, and general engineering applications due to their versatility and cost-effectiveness.

What are the advantages of using deep groove ball bearings?

Advantages include their high running accuracy, low friction, ability to operate at high speeds, relatively low cost, and low maintenance requirements. They are also available in many designs and sizes to suit different needs.
